The rural forest landscape of the Kabale District is home to various tribes that are constantly trying to sustain themselves.  Development In Gardening's mission in this region is similar to the Kenya project. One of the tribes involved in the community farming program is the Batwa.  The Batwa is the most underserved and marginalized tribes in Uganda.  Originally a hunter-gatherer tribe of the Echuya Forest until banished by the Ugandan Government in 1991 to establish a National Park for the Guerrillas, the Batwa struggle to survive.  No longer recognized by the Ugandan Government and with no land to call their own they rely on programs like Development In Gardening.
